Question
when a 105 gram solid is added to 43 ml of water, the water level rises to 88 ml. what is the density of the solid?
0.43 g/ml
2.3 g/ml
0.84 g/ml
1.2 g/ml
Step1: Find volume of solid
The volume of the solid is equal to the volume of water displaced. Volume of water displaced = final volume of water - initial volume of water. So, $V = 88\ mL - 43\ mL=45\ mL$.
Step2: Calculate density
The density formula is $
ho=\frac{m}{V}$, where $m = 105\ g$ and $V = 45\ mL$. Then $
ho=\frac{105\ g}{45\ mL}\approx2.3\ g/mL$.
